Output 84fbb4559bdbc1c66bb1712421335e2480b5fca289468a47e25d865a54b2d036:1

value
21743268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a6dc08da66d43f10d65acfa8b7aa417c255df07 OP_EQUALVERIFY OP_CHECKSIG
address
1Pq9QfwpLeCVNuMcdUebqVmnkrysyYwP49
transaction
84fbb4559bdbc1c66bb1712421335e2480b5fca289468a47e25d865a54b2d036
spent
true